Understanding Metformin HCL 500 mg

Metformin HCL (Hydrochloride) 500 mg is an oral medication used to manage type 2 diabetes. It belongs to a class of drugs known as biguanides. Unlike some other diabetes medications, Metformin does not cause the pancreas to produce more insulin. Instead, it works by improving the body’s sensitivity to insulin and reducing the amount of sugar produced by the liver.

How Metformin HCL 500 mg Works

  1. Decreases Liver Glucose Production: One of the primary functions of Glycomet online is to inhibit the liver's ability to produce glucose. This helps prevent high blood sugar levels, especially between meals and overnight.

  2. Enhances Insulin Sensitivity: Metformin increases the sensitivity of muscle and fat cells to insulin. This allows the body to use insulin more effectively, facilitating the uptake of glucose from the bloodstream into cells where it can be used for energy.

  3. Reduces Intestinal Absorption of Glucose: Metformin also reduces the amount of glucose absorbed from the food you eat, which helps lower blood sugar levels after meals.

Benefits of Metformin HCL 500 mg

  • Effective Blood Sugar Control: Metformin is highly effective in lowering and maintaining blood sugar levels within the target range for many individuals with type 2 diabetes.
  • Weight Management: Unlike some diabetes medications that can cause weight gain, Metformin is often associated with weight stability or even weight loss in some patients.
  • Cardiovascular Benefits: Research has shown that Metformin may have cardiovascular benefits, reducing the risk of heart disease and stroke in people with type 2 diabetes.
  • Low Risk of Hypoglycemia: Metformin does not usually cause hypoglycemia (low blood sugar) when used alone, making it a safer option for many patients.

Tips for Effective Use of Metformin HCL 500 mg

  1. Follow Prescribed Dosage: Always take Metformin exactly as prescribed by your healthcare provider. Do not alter the dose without consulting your doctor.

  2. Take with Meals: Taking Metformin with meals can help reduce gastrointestinal side effects such as nausea and diarrhea.

  3. Monitor Blood Sugar Levels: Regularly monitor your blood sugar levels to ensure the medication is working effectively and to make any necessary adjustments with your healthcare provider.

  4. Maintain a Healthy Diet: Pairing Metformin with a balanced diet rich in fiber, lean proteins, and healthy fats can enhance its effectiveness in controlling blood sugar levels.

  5. Stay Active: Regular physical activity can help improve insulin sensitivity and overall blood sugar control.

Possible Side Effects

While Metformin is generally well-tolerated, some people may experience side effects, especially when they first start taking the medication. Common side effects include:

  • Nausea
  • Diarrhea
  • Stomach pain
  • Loss of appetite

These side effects often improve over time. If they persist or become severe, it is important to contact your healthcare provider.
